L'hacker di iPhone e PS3: gli agenti che scrivono codice sono un errore enorme

Per George Hotz non basta che il codice funzioni, deve anche poter essere mantenuto.



[ZEUS News - www.zeusnews.it - 28-05-2026]

hotz programmazione agenti errore
Foto di Compagnons.

Mentre i grandi nomi dell'informatica sembrano volersi affidare completamente alla generazione di codice da parte dei Large Language Models (LLM), qualche voce contraria sta iniziando a manifestarsi. Di recente il noto hacker e informatico George Hotz ha messo in guardia dai pericoli che questo approccio nasconde. Egli sostiene che i cosiddetti coding agent rappresentino uno dei più grandi errori strategici nello sviluppo software contemporaneo, un approccio che rischia di aumentare costi, complessità e dipendenza da sistemi automatici difficili da controllare. Hotz, noto per i suoi lavori di reverse engineering, sulla guida autonoma e sui modelli linguistici, ha affermato che l'idea di delegare l'intero sviluppo a sistemi automatici è «una delle decisioni più costose che l'industria possa prendere»: ha spiegato che l'automazione totale introduce livelli di opacità incompatibili con la manutenzione a lungo termine. Il problema di fondo è la distanza crescente tra codice generato e codice comprensibile per gli sviluppatori, un divario che rischia di rendere più difficile intervenire in caso di errori.

Le critiche di Hotz si inseriscono in un contesto in cui molte aziende stanno sperimentando agenti capaci di operare su codice reale, modificando configurazioni e operando in autonomia. Hotz sostiene che questi sistemi, se non progettati con limiti chiari, possano introdurre regressioni difficili da individuare. Ha dichiarato che «un agente che modifica codice senza che nessuno lo capisca è un rischio operativo enorme», sottolineando che la responsabilità finale rimane comunque in capo ai team "umani". L'informatico non critica l'uso dell'IA come strumento di supporto, ma l'idea di affidare all'agente l'intero ciclo di sviluppo. La sua posizione è che gli strumenti di assistenza - come completamento del codice, suggerimenti contestuali e analisi statica avanzata - abbiano un valore concreto, mentre gli agenti autonomi rischino di generare più lavoro di quanto ne eliminino. Il problema principale, secondo lui, è la mancanza di trasparenza nei processi decisionali dei modelli.

Hotz ha evidenziato che l'adozione massiccia di agenti autonomi potrebbe portare a un aumento dei costi di manutenzione. Le modifiche automatiche, se non perfettamente tracciate e spiegabili, richiedono audit più frequenti e complessi. Le aziende che implementano questi sistemi potrebbero trovarsi a dover investire in nuovi livelli di controllo, verifiche e strumenti di monitoraggio per garantire che il codice generato non introduca vulnerabilità o comportamenti indesiderati.

Un altro punto sollevato riguarda la qualità del codice prodotto dagli agenti. Secondo le fonti, Hotz ritiene che i modelli linguistici siano ottimi nel generare soluzioni superficiali, ma meno affidabili nel gestire architetture complesse o vincoli non esplicitati. Ciò può portare a un accumulo di debito tecnico difficile da smaltire. La sua posizione è che «il codice deve essere scritto per essere mantenuto, non solo per funzionare al primo tentativo».

Le sue osservazioni arrivano in un momento in cui molte aziende stanno annunciando agenti capaci di gestire repository completi. Alcuni progetti sperimentali hanno mostrato agenti che aprono centinaia di pull request in pochi minuti, un comportamento che secondo Hotz rischia di saturare i processi di revisione - come di recente ha confermato anche Linus Torvalds - e di rendere più difficile distinguere modifiche utili da modifiche cosmetiche o ridondanti. Hotz ha anche criticato l'idea che gli agenti possano sostituire completamente gli sviluppatori. La sua tesi è che la programmazione non sia solo scrittura di codice, ma comprensione dei sistemi, modellazione dei problemi e gestione delle interazioni tra componenti. Gli agenti, secondo lui, non possiedono ancora una rappresentazione strutturata sufficiente per assumere questo ruolo.

Il dibattito si inserisce nella discussione più ampia sul futuro dello sviluppo software. Alcuni ricercatori ritengono che gli agenti possano ridurre drasticamente i tempi di produzione, mentre altri condividono le preoccupazioni di Hotz sulla manutenibilità e sulla responsabilità. Le aziende che stanno sperimentando questi sistemi stanno già introducendo limiti operativi, come sandbox dedicate, revisioni obbligatorie e restrizioni sulle aree del codice modificabili. La posizione di Hotz ha avuto ampia risonanza nel web tra gli sviluppatori, che per lo più vedono nei coding agent una tecnologia promettente ma ancora immatura. Le sue osservazioni evidenziano la necessità di bilanciare automazione e controllo umano, soprattutto in contesti in cui la stabilità del software è un requisito critico.

Se questo articolo ti è piaciuto e vuoi rimanere sempre informato con Zeus News ti consigliamo di iscriverti alla Newsletter gratuita. Inoltre puoi consigliare l'articolo utilizzando uno dei pulsanti qui sotto, inserire un commento (anche anonimo) o segnalare un refuso.
© RIPRODUZIONE RISERVATA

Approfondimenti
LLM, algoritmi e debito tecnologico

Commenti all'articolo (ultimi 5 di 6)

Alle varie aziende non gliene frega nulla della manutenzione futura di un programma gestionale. per loro roba come i programmi in COBOL che gestiscono il sistema previdenziale americano che hanno più di 50 anni sono una eresia folle, se un programma non funziona, lo cambiamo con una nuova! La IA-LLM si e sbagliata! gli facciamo... Leggi tutto
1-6-2026 19:25

non quasi, e l'unico, con l'aggiunta che quello che ti dice il modello non e coperto da alcuna garanzia :x Leggi tutto
1-6-2026 18:56

Infatti il punto è proprio la leggibilità del codice e se c'è già chi pensa che sarebbe più efficiente far si che gli agenti scrivessero direttamente in codice macchina come Andrej Karpathy di Anthropic non stiamo affatto messi bene e ciò che dice Hotz dovrebbe essere preso in serissima considerazione. Leggi tutto
30-5-2026 15:42

{UtenteAnonimo}
@andbad No gli LLM scrivono meglio in linguaggi di alto livello e difficilmente sarebbero efficaci con linguaggi di basso livello come il linguaggio macchia. Quindi si Claude scrive in C e Java per necessità non per scelta. Un LLM necessità, per apprendere bene, di una certa densità informativa nel linguaggio e... Leggi tutto
30-5-2026 14:41

Il problema non è che gli LLM possano generare codice con errori, perché la stessa cosa accade anche con gli umani (non saprei dirti se con maggiore o minore frequenza). Il problema è la manutenibilità (come dice Hotz): il codice scritto da umani è per lo più leggibile e se c'è un bug con un po' di fatica si scova. Se gli LLM cominciano... Leggi tutto
29-5-2026 13:07

La liberta' di parola e' un diritto inviolabile, ma nei forum di Zeus News vige un regolamento che impone delle restrizioni e che l'utente e' tenuto a rispettare. I moderatori si riservano il diritto di cancellare o modificare i commenti inseriti dagli utenti, senza dover fornire giustificazione alcuna. Gli utenti non registrati al forum inoltre sono sottoposti a moderazione preventiva. La responsabilita' dei commenti ricade esclusivamente sui rispettivi autori. I principali consigli: rimani sempre in argomento; evita commenti offensivi, volgari, violenti o che inneggiano all'illegalita'; non inserire dati personali, link inutili o spam in generale.
E' VIETATA la riproduzione dei testi e delle immagini senza l'espressa autorizzazione scritta di Zeus News. Tutti i marchi e i marchi registrati citati sono di proprietà delle rispettive società. Informativa sulla privacy. I tuoi suggerimenti sono di vitale importanza per Zeus News. Contatta la redazione e contribuisci anche tu a migliorare il sito: pubblicheremo sui forum le lettere piu' interessanti.
Sondaggio
Come preferiresti controllare la Tv?
Con lo smartphone
Con il tablet
Con i gesti del corpo
Con la voce
Con il pensiero
Con il telecomando

Mostra i risultati (2324 voti)
Giugno 2026
Debutta Euro-Office tra le proteste di LibreOffice
Lo strumento che ti dice quali modelli IA puoi eseguire davvero sul tuo PC
ChatGPT, arriva Lockdown Mode
Iliad lancia il suo FWA: modem 5G, attivazione rapida e velocità fino a 300 Mbps
Microsoft: sistema operativo e app sono al capolinea. È l'ora degli agenti IA
Quousque tandem abutere, Ursula, patientia nostra?
Grave falla in 7-Zip
Maggio 2026
Denunce ai Carabinieri sull'app IO
Apre Virtual OS Museum: 75 anni di sistemi operativi
Crisi delle memorie, la luce in fondo al tunnel
Copilot invade Excel
49.000 persone senza elettricità: il fornitore preferisce alimentare i datacenter della IA
Gmail, lo spazio gratuito si riduce a 5 Gbyte
Crisi della RAM, in vendita DDR 5 false con i chip in fibra di vetro
Windows 11 accelera davvero
Tutti gli Arretrati
Accadde oggi - 12 giugno


web metrics